WASHINGTON – People from across the country rallied in Washington on Thursday to celebrate and protect the lives of the unborn in our nation, Rep. Tim Huelskamp said. The Kansas Republican joined pro-life supporters at the March for Life, again promising to support the Pain-Capable Unborn Child Protection Act, H.R. 36.
 “I am eager to be joined by concerned citizens from across the country as we Rally for Life in Washington at the 42nd March for Life,” Huelskamp stated prior to the rally.
 “My wife Angela and I have been active in the pro-life cause, because it is the right thing to do. But also as parents of four children by adoption, the issue is close to our hearts. As the Republican Whip of the Pro-Life Caucus, I am privileged to play a role in encouraging other representatives to advance legislation that protects the unborn and promotes adoption.
 “In the last Congress, I supported the Pain-Capable Unborn Child Protection Act, but it was blocked by then-Leader Harry Reid. Today, we have a new Congress with Republican majorities in both the House and the Senate. I pray that Republicans will pass this bill by voting with their constituents and defending the sacred right to life.”
The No Taxpayer Funding for Abortion Act passed the House on Thursday by a vote of 242 to 179.
